ACCURACY OF TURNING FLOW ESTIMATES AT ROAD JUNCTIONS
An estimation method is described which provides a means of calculating turning flows at intersections where in- and out-flows are known, and turning proportions are determined from a knowledge of turning flows by counts carried out in the past. The study described here assesses the accuracy of the estimation method when applied to a number of intersections in Kuwait. Attention is foucsed on the variation of acuracy with the magnitude of the estimated flows. The results of the study showed that there is a tendency for large flows to be underestimated, while smaller flows are overestimated. This method of estimation based on historical data is capable of providing satisfactory estimates of turning flows at many intersections in Kuwait.
